Job Summary

Amazon is looking for a Business Intelligence Engineer to identify strategic initiatives that will form the next generation of Amazon Logistics. As a Business Intelligence Engineer you will be working in one of the worlds largest and most complex data warehouse this role you will primarily work on designing and building automated reporting and dashboards using complex data. We are still in the nascent stage so it is an exciting opportunity to be involved from design-to-execution. As a BI Engineer you will operate as a mix of hands-on builder and influencer.

The teams success depends on our ability to create actionable insight from the data that we and our partners generate. The ideal BIE candidate will have excellent analytical abilities business acumen high judgment strong technical skills and good written and verbal communication skills. This person will be a self-starter comfortable with ambiguity able to think big and be creative (while paying careful attention to detail) and enjoys working in a fast-paced dynamic environment. To be successful in this role you should have broad skills in data mining be comfortable dealing with large and complex data sets while applying analytical rigor to solve business problems.

In this cross-functional role you will work closely with partners in Product Management Training and Program Management to design and deliver data needs. You will have strong analytical and communication skills and be able to work with product managers and business development teams to define key business questions and build data sets and models that answer them.





Key job responsibilities
- Develop complex queries for ad hoc requests and projects as well as ongoing reporting.
- Design develop and maintain scalable automated user-friendly systems reports dashboards etc. that will support our analytical and business needs
- Design implement and support key datasets that provide structured and timely access to actionable business information addressing stakeholder needs.
- Interface directly with stakeholders gathering requirements and owning automated end-to-end reporting solutions.
- Partner with analysts data engineers business intelligence engineers and software development engineers across Amazon to produce complete data solutions.
- Simplify and automate reporting audits and other data-driven activities; build solutions to have maximum scale and self-service ability by stakeholders
- Learn and understand a broad range of Amazons data resources and know how when and which to use.
- Estimate models write analyses and extract insights and provide business recommendations.


About the team
We serve AMZLs Learning teams as the strategic thought leader looking beyond where other teams are focused to drive transformative solutions that leverage technology and processes to improve learning outcomes and drive down the cost to serve.

- 3 years of analyzing and interpreting data with Redshift Oracle NoSQL etc. experience
- Experience with data visualization using Tableau Quicksight or similar tools
- Experience with data modeling warehousing and building ETL pipelines
- Experience in Statistical Analysis packages such as R SAS and Matlab
- Experience using SQL to pull data from a database or data warehouse and scripting experience (Python) to process data for modeling
- Experience with SQL

- Experience with AWS solutions such as EC2 DynamoDB S3 and Redshift
- Experience in data mining ETL etc. and using databases in a business environment with large-scale complex datasets
